How many does a gallon of ice cream tub serve?
How many people a gallon of ice cream serves depends on how much each person eats. If each person eats 1 cup, the gallon will serve 16 people because there are 16 cups in a gallon. If a person eats half a cup, approximately the amount in the average scoop of ice cream, the gallon will serve 32 people.
How many scoops of ice cream are in a 5 gallon?
Calculating the scoops of ice cream per gallon, then, is just basic math. It’s 2 scoops to the cup, 2 cups to the pint, 2 pints to the quart, and 4 quarts to the gallon. That works out to 32 scoops per gallon of ice cream, though in real life, your scoops won’t usually be that exact.
How many ounces are in a gallon of ice cream?
Now that you know how many ounces of ice cream you need, convert them to gallons. A true gallon consists of 128 ounces, although many containers labeled as a gallon only contain about 96 ounces. If you are unsure about the conversion for the brand you wish to purchase, simply keep the measurement as ounces.

How much milk does it take to make ice cream?
UDDERLY AMAZING! A cow gives enough milk to make: 2 gallons of ice cream per day. It takes 3 gallons of milk to make 1 gallon of ice cream. About 9% of all milk produced in the US is used to make ice cream.

How many servings of ice cream in a gallon?
This information is based on the traditional 1/2 cup servings of ice cream. 4 servings = pint of ice cream. 8 servings = quart of ice cream. 16 servings = half gallon of ice cream. 32 servings = gallon of ice cream. 64 servings = 2 gallons of ice cream. 96 servings = 3 gallons of ice cream.

How many people will a gallon of ice cream feed?
If you’re serving ice cream alongside cake, pie and other foods, you can usually assume that a gallon will serve approximately 20 to 25 people.
